Hi List, I am currently testing the sqllog function of pam-mysql.
And of course I am running into a (minor) problem. I've made the following additional entries to my working /etc/pam.d/imap file: sqllog=true logtable=log logmsgcolumn=msg logusercolumn=user loghostcolumn=host logpidcolumn=pid logtimecolumn=time All but the loghostcolumn get logged. So it is kind of working, except for the host column being empty. I really would also like to have the corresponding host logged. In the regular mail log files the host is logged perfectly. libpam-mysql is Version 0.5 (Debian stable package). Any suggestions/tips/hints?
